Output f5feecdbc203001f7b80b9ac605367c4ed1d2b55efbda41ef4fd4180cb7f176a:22

value
2170276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3dfe19052daa97062e1c81b9b27b1f4be15210 OP_EQUAL
address
A8EHptu9XSyqdQvvkoejqxthuJ62qoFVCX
transaction
f5feecdbc203001f7b80b9ac605367c4ed1d2b55efbda41ef4fd4180cb7f176a